Method

Cajun Turkey Directions

  1. 1

    Prepare the Turkey

    Preheat your smoker to 225°F (107°C). Rinse the turkey breast under cold water and pat dry with paper towels.

  2. 2

    Apply Cajun Rub

    Rub the cajun spice all over the turkey breast, ensuring it's evenly coated. Let it sit for at least 30 minutes to absorb the flavors.

  3. 3

    Smoke the Turkey

    Place the turkey breast in the smoker and smoke for approximately 2 to 3 hours,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).

  4. 4

    Cook the Bacon

    While the turkey is smoking, cook the bacon in a skillet over medium heat until crispy. Remove from the skillet and drain on paper towels.

  5. 5

    Prepare Vegetables

    Slice the tomato and cucumber thinly. Set aside.

  6. 6

    Assemble the Sandwich

    Once the turkey is done smoking, allow it to rest for 10 minutes before slicing. Layer the turkey, bacon, baby spinach, sliced tomato, sliced cucumber, and sharp cheddar cheese on your choice of bread. Drizzle with chipotle sauce.

  7. 7

    Serve

    Cut the sandwich in half and serve immediately. Enjoy your Cajun Turkey sandwich!
